| Castle Tour of North Sealand |
7 hours |
|
As you leave Copenhagen and head north, for almost a whole hour the coastline of Sweden unravels as you continue through magnificent Danish countryside and coastline towards Elsinore and Kronborg Castle. Now amongst the universal cultural heritage, under the UNESCO convention, Kronborg has reached exclusive status for being the only example of a Renaissance Castle. It is easy to understand why William Shakespeare chose Kronborg Castle as the setting for his famous play 'Hamlet' as you enjoy the beautiful surroundings. You will be able to explore the castle's interior as you are taken through the Chapel and the Knights' Hall (the longest room in Northern Europe) and the dark casemates.
After a lunch break (not included), the tour continues towards Fredensborg, where the Queen's summer residence of Fredensborg Palace is attractively located in the middle of a lovely park, bordering the idyllic Esrum Lake.
The next highlight on this tour of many highlights is Frederiksborg Castle, built by King Christian IV in 1601 - 1625. This pearl of history, built in magnificent Renaissance style with a touch of baroque, is now a national historical museum, containing treasures of painting, tapestry, porcelain, silver and furniture.
This tour is the classic amongst excursions while visiting Denmark.
